Event Details: 

The Richard Murtagh Memorial Moot is an exciting opportunity for student members of Middle Temple who have not yet obtained pupillage to participate in a specialist criminal law moot. 

The competition combines both written and oral advocacy skills, giving participants the opportunity to develop their advocacy and strengthen pupillage applications.

The moot problem, competition rules (including deadlines) and registration form can be found on the Middle Temple mooting page

In order to obtain the Qualifying Session students must attend for the whole day, including the discussion of the legal issues and the reception. Students are not required to moot in order to obtain the QS i.e. observers will also secure the QS if they are present for the entire day.

Qualifying Session Details:

For Middle Temple students and transferring lawyers - this event counts as one Qualifying Session.  To be awarded the QS for this event you are required to arrive on time and attend all elements of this event (please see timings at the top of this page).  You must hand your ticket to the Front of House staff on duty on arrival.  Failure to do so will mean that the QS will not be awarded.
